I do water changes with ro/di water. I take out 5G, and I have a 5G pail of
fresh water mixed to 1.023. Is there anything else I should be adding to the water when I mix the 5G pail or is all I need already in the salt mix? I use red sea salt. Another thing that gets me is my water's only pH 7.9. Do you recommend I do a water change with water at 8.0, then 8.1, then 8.2 until the tank gradually gets up there and add some marine buffer to the system when it gets there so it stays? How slowly should I do this so I don't shock my fish? TIA. John |

Using RO/DI, all you need is salt. Match salinity, temperature to within one
degree) to your tank and pour it in. I don't do anything about pH myself. If you are adding 5g to a 50g tank, the lower pH won't affect the bigger volume of water.
